Stocks making the biggest moves after hours: Chegg, Clorox and more

Try the firms making headlines after the bell

Chegg — Shares of Chegg sunk more than 25% in prolonged buying and selling after a weaker-than-expected quarterly report. The training know-how firm reported income of $171.9 million versus $174.5 million estimated, in line with Refinitiv. Chegg additionally missed subscriber estimates.

Clorox — Clorox shares rose over 5% after hours following an earnings beat. The buyer merchandise firm reported an adjusted revenue of $1.21 per share on income of $1.81 billion. Analysts anticipated earnings of $1.03 per share on income of $1.70 billion, in line with Refinitiv.

Avis Price range Group — Shares of Avis Price range Group rose almost 5% in after-hours buying and selling following a powerful third-quarter earnings report. The guardian firm of automobile rental manufacturers reported adjusted earnings per share of $10.74, a lot greater than the Refinitiv consensus of $6.52 per share. Income got here in higher-than-expected at $3 billion versus $2.715 billion estimated. Avis additionally introduced a $1 billion enhance to the firm’s current share repurchase authorization.

NXP Semiconductors — NXP Semiconductors shares whipsawed throughout prolonged buying and selling after reporting a slight quarterly income beat. The chipmaker reported income of $2.86 billion, whereas analysts anticipated income of $2.85 billion, in line with Refinitiv.

Simon Property Group — Simon Property Group shares gained 3% in prolonged buying and selling after the mall proprietor beat earnings expectations soundly. The corporate reported earnings of $2.07 per share versus $1.09 per share anticipated by analysts surveyed by Refinitv. The corporate’s income additionally got here in greater than anticipated.
